Windows and Doors in the UK: A Comprehensive Guide

The choice of windows and doors is a crucial aspect of home construction and restoration in the UK. They not just influence the aesthetic appeals of a property however also its energy performance, security, and convenience. In this post, we will explore the different types of windows and doors offered in the UK, their products, advantages, and energy scores, along with some often asked questions.

Kinds of Doors

Doors are equally crucial, working as the entry points to a home and adding to its overall security and style. Here are typical door types discovered in the UK:

1. Front Doors

  • Description: The primary entrance of a home.
  • Products: Often made from timber, composite, or uPVC.
  • Benefits:
    • First impression of a home
    • Enhanced security choices
    • Insulation benefits

2. French Doors

  • Description: Double doors that open outwards or inwards.
  • Advantages:
    • Ideal for connecting indoor and outside areas
    • Customizable with glass designs

3. Bi-Fold Doors

  • Description: Doors that fold back in areas, popular for patios.
  • Benefits:
    • Create wide-open spaces in between inside and outside
    • Energy-efficient choices offered

4. Sliding Doors

  • Description: Doors that slide along a track.
  • Benefits:
    • Space-efficient style
    • Modern look, maximizes light

5. Composite Doors

  • Description: Made from a combination of products to improve strength and insulation.
  • Advantages:
    • High resilience
    • Excellent thermal effectiveness
    • Variety of design and styles

Energy Efficiency and Ratings

Energy efficiency is a key consideration when selecting windows and doors. The ideal choice can considerably decrease heating costs and boost convenience in the home. In the UK, windows and doors are typically rated utilizing the Energy Savings Trust's system, which appoints a score from A to G, where A is the most effective.

Advantages of Energy-Efficient Windows and Doors:

  • Lower energy expenses
  • Decrease in carbon footprint
  • Improved comfort levels (less draughty)
  • Potential financial incentives and grants available
Energy RatingDescription
AExtremely energy-efficient, best option
BExcellent energy effectiveness, still a solid choice
CTypical energy effectiveness
DBelow par, think about upgrades
E, F, GPoor energy performance, not recommended

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

What materials are best for doors and windows?

Materials such as uPVC, lumber, and aluminum prevail options. uPVC is popular for its cost-effectiveness and low upkeep, while wood uses a timeless visual however needs regular maintenance. Aluminum is strong and contemporary, ideal for larger frames.

How do I know if I require new windows or doors?

Indications consist of drafts, problem opening systems, condensation between panes, or visible heat loss. If the looks are significantly aged or harmed, it may likewise be time to consider replacements.

What is the typical life-span of windows and doors?

Generally, windows can last anywhere from 15 to thirty years, depending on the material and upkeep. Doors can last longer, however wear and tear from exposure may need replacements quicker.

Are energy-efficient doors and windows worth the investment?

Yes, they can substantially minimize energy bills, improve convenience, and increase the worth of a residential or commercial property. Many property owners find that the savings frequently offset the in advance cost within a couple of years.
